The story of the goddess
When nothing existed and darkness was everywhere, Maa Kushmanda created the cosmos with a gentle smile. That is why she is called the original power of creation. She is believed to live within the sun and give light and energy to the whole world from there. She has eight arms, so she is also called Ashtabhuja Devi, and she rides a lion. Her worship is considered especially good for health and long life.
How to do the puja
Offer malpua as bhog along with red or yellow flowers. After the puja, share the malpua as prasad with family and neighbours. Chant the mantra and pray for the health of everyone at home.
Mantra
ॐ देवी कूष्माण्डायै नमः
Om Devi Kushmandayai Namah
